Johnson recently had the opportunity to sit down with Frances Hannon, the brilliant hair and makeup designer responsible for the iconic looks of the characters in the Wicked films.

Frances Hannon, a highly acclaimed artist who has received both an Oscar and a BAFTA for her outstanding work, faced the monumental challenge of translating the captivating characters of Wicked from the Broadway stage to the big screen. With the first film already out and the second installment scheduled for release in 2025, Hannon had the daunting task of designing the hair, makeup, and prosthetics for over 3,000 background actors as well as the main characters.

One of the major hurdles Hannon encountered was adapting the appearances of the lead characters, Glinda and Elphaba, for the film adaptation. Unlike the stage actors who traditionally embody these roles, the film cast brought unique features that required careful consideration. For example, Ariana Grande, portraying Glinda in the film, has dark hair and eyes, unlike the character’s usual light features. Similarly, Cynthia Erivo as Elphaba needed to authentically look green rather than just being painted green to transport viewers into the magical world of Wicked.

In her interview, Hannon shares the inspiration behind Ariana Grande’s look, the necessity of prosthetic ears for Cynthia Erivo’s transformation, and even teases a hairstyle that Grande won’t be seen sporting in the film.
